The Plenum is a regular meeting of all people involved with the space to talk about things, and decide stuff.

If you have stuff to add, go right ahead! Please sign your points with your name (by adding a "--~~~~" after your text).

Preamble

  • The Plenum is an institution to decide on what the space should look like, physically and in other ways, such as virtually.
  • Things concerning the space should be discussed at a plenum.
  • Everyone who's there can participate in that process, member or otherwise.
  • Everyone can head a plenum, no need for board members to do that.
  • Topics should ideally be announced on the Plenum wiki page beforehand
  • The Plenum should be held in a language that everyone participating understands.

Ask the owner before "repairing" free-to-use stuff

Last week German noticed his lab bench power supply, he provided free-to-use for our electronics corner, is not working any longer. Apparently someone tried to repair it, thereby voiding the warranty. I'd like to remind everyone that you should ask the owner before trying to repair/open up things by yourself. Only if you can rely on this, members are willing to provide us with free-to-use machinery and devices. --David (talk)

Theft of money from the drinks box

Over the last few weeks we noticed that money is missing from our drinks box. By now we're sure that it was stolen. Please keep your eyes open if guests are within the space. Currently we're trying to empty the box often, so there is not that much money inside. Thanks to Peter and German for helping with this. Additionally, huge thanks to Germans boss for donating to compensate for the missing money. --David (talk)

Repair Cafe on Saturday

This Saturday we are participating at the repair cafe at IMAL. Over the last few weeks several people showed up with their broken electric devices, so it would be great if some of us show up, to help repairing these. --David (talk)

Funding for 3D Printer & Machinery

I'd like to make an application for funding at the Bezirksauschuss (kind of a council for the city borough). One possibility might be to get a replacement for the two stolen 3D printers. --David (talk)

Insurances & Liability

David is currently evaluation our possibilties regarding insurances and liabilities. As we are a member of the VOW, we currently have a basic liability insurance. Additionally, we can can insure our inventory (150-300 EUR), and take out an accident insurance policy (around 300 EUR). Regarding the liability issue (It's quite complex) I will do some more reading, and give you an update at the next plenum. --David (talk)
